There are plenty of reasons to quit smoking. Your heart, lungs, even your finances will see an improvement ! Here are just a few:

*Increased Lung Power; Three sure signs of a smoker are wheezing, coughing and shortness of breath. Your lungs are working overtime. Quit, and in 2 to 3 months you'll be glad you did.

*Save money
*No More Smoky Smell
*Healthier Looking Skin
*Decreased Cancer Risks

*Live Longer; People who quit smoking live longer than those who smoke, because quitting reduces the risk of dying from specific smoking-related diseases

*A Strong Heart

*Food Tastes Better; Smoking can dull your sense of smell and taste. As you regain your senses after you quit smoking, you’ll notice eating can be more pleasurable.

*Better Sex; Studies looking at men who smoke have found that they are more likely to have impotence (erectile dysfunction).

*A Quiet’s Night’s Sleep; Smoking could be the reason you (and your partner) are tossing and turning at night.

*Freedom; Think about it. Once you’re no longer tied to your smoking habit, you’ll feel a sense of freedom.
